Softball Welcomes Mount St. Mary's for NEC Weekend Series

HACKENSACK, N.J. – The Fairleigh Dickinson softball team is set for a four-game weekend series against Mount St. Mary's beginning Saturday and concluding Sunday. The teams will play doubleheaders, with the first set of games being played on Saturday at 1 p.m. and 3 p.m. and on Sunday at 12 p.m. and 2 p.m.

NEC Season Format and Preseason Poll
There will be a 32-game conference schedule that will be played in a round-robin (four-game series) format over eight weeks from March 20-May 9. The NEC will only have four teams qualify for a double-elimination NEC Championship that will take place from May 13-15. FDU was predicted to finish seventh in the NEC Preseason Poll.

Scouting the Mountaineers
Mount St. Mary's has opened NEC action with four losses to CCSU, three wins against Bryant, and one win and three losses against LIU. MSM is led offensively by freshman Tori Bowles who is tied for the team lead with three homers and leads the team in RBI's with 19. Fellow freshman Bridgette Gilliano has totaled 14 RBI's and belted three homers to this point in the season. Graduate student Kaylee Stoner leads the team in batting average with a .315 average and total bases with 40. Senior Amanda Berkley has a team-low ERA of 2.70, has pitched four complete games, and has logged 44 career strikeouts.

Scouting the Knights
FDU has opened the NEC action with series losses to LIU and Central Connecticut State and defeated SFU in one of four games earlier this week. In the most recent NEC series against SFU, the Knights won game two of the series by a 3-1 margin. Junior Alayna Savaglio threw her second consecutive complete game as she went seven innings, only allowed one run, and struck out seven batters. Graduate student Madison Emerson went 3-4 with two doubles and drove in all three RBI's in the win. On the season, Emerson leads the team with a .300 batting average, two homers, 12 hits, and eight RBI's. Junior Courtney Mahoney ranks second on the team with a .286 batting average and has logged 10 hits. Savaglio leads the team with a 3.47 ERA, two complete games, 43 strikeouts, and a 1.34 WHIP.
